A professional technician will first inspect your existing pump. This includes checking the motor, impeller, seals, and electrical connections. Accurate assessment ensures the right replacement pump is chosen.
Before beginning the replacement, turn off the power supply to the pool pump and close water valves. This step prevents accidents and water leakage during the process.
Carefully disconnect the plumbing and electrical connections. Remove the pump from its base and inspect for any damage that may need addressing before installing the new unit.
Choose a high-efficiency pump suitable for your pool size and usage. Infinity Pool Services Pte Ltd recommends selecting pumps with energy-saving features to reduce long-term operational costs.
Secure the new pump to the base and reconnect the plumbing and electrical lines. Ensure all connections are tight and leak-free. Proper installation is critical for efficient water circulation.
Fill the pump strainer with water and ensure the impeller is fully primed. Priming prevents airlocks, which can damage the motor and reduce efficiency.
Turn on the power and check for proper flow, noise, and vibration. Make any necessary adjustments to optimize performance. This step confirms the pump is working efficiently and safely.
